Outstanding Researcher

Who qualifies under "Outstanding professors or researchers" status? 

 

In order to qualify as an outstanding professor or researcher, you must show at least 2 of the following:

 Receipt of major international prizes or awards for outstanding achievement in the academic field. 

 Membership in associations in the academic field, which require outstanding achievements of their members. 

 Published material in professional publications written by others about the applicant's work in the field. 

 Evidence of participation, on a panel or individually, as the judge of the work of others in the same or allied academic field. 

 Evidence of original scientific or scholarly research contributions to the academic field. 

 Evidence of authorship of scholarly books or articles in scholarly journals with international circulation.

 

Important Note: The evidence must establish that the beneficiary is a researcher or professor who is internationally recognized as outstanding. Merely presenting evidence, which relates to two of the listed criteria, does not necessarily mean that the priority worker petition will be approved.
